Monetary knowledge community Plaid launches a shopper credit score rating

The financial-technology agency Plaid Inc. is launching a credit-score service to offer banks and fintechs extra detailed and well timed info on shoppers’ monetary well being.

Plaid — whose companies join banks and fintechs — is launching LendScore, a score that can vary from 1-99 with a specific deal with serving to lenders serving subprime and near-prime shoppers, in line with an announcement Wednesday. 

Actual-time cash-flow knowledge shall be used to generate the rankings, not like different scores that will current a delayed evaluation of a shopper’s creditworthiness. Conventional scores usually take into consideration components reminiscent of fee historical past and age, in addition to kinds of credit score already utilized and to what extent. Money-flow knowledge is completely different, given its timeliness.

“In the event you get a brand new job and you’ve got extra earnings, but your bills keep the identical, then it is best to qualify for a greater mortgage price,” Plaid Chief Government Officer Zach Perret mentioned in an interview.

Honest Isaac Corp. has till now confronted just about no competitors for its well-known FICO scores. However VantageScore Options, a enterprise by the three main credit-reporting companies, recently gained a authorities stamp of approval to broaden within the mortgage area, edging in on FICO’s territory. 

Plaid mentioned LendScore ought to be seen as complementary to FICO scores and different conventional gamers within the area, however there may very well be room for disruption sooner or later.

Plaid’s benefit in introducing LendScore is the in depth shopper knowledge the corporate already has entry to, given its community connections with financial-services companies. At least half of all US shoppers have encountered Plaid’s know-how indirectly. By means of these connections, Plaid’s rating can present lenders with real-time insights about would-be debtors, reminiscent of money stream into and out of financial institution accounts.

Income from Plaid’s new lending, funds and anti-fraud merchandise has doubled up to now 12 months, in line with an individual acquainted with the corporate’s financials.

LendScore can be utilized in tandem with conventional scores, and rankings may also be mixed to provide you with a weighted composite, in line with the assertion.

Plaid additionally has a tie-up with Experian Plc, an organization well-known for creating shopper credit score stories. 

“Our view is that the cash-flow underwriting area is so nascent proper now that there’s worth in working collectively,” mentioned Wealthy Franks, Plaid’s head of credit score.
